    The layout for Micro ATX vs Micro BTX is mirror image.

    Optiplex models have been around for 27 years now.

    Dell does not publish pinouts for front panel, thermal sensor, fan headers etc.

    There is no such thing as one size fits all for Optiplex or any other series like XPS or Inspiron etc.

    BTX or Balanced Technology eXtended is a form factor of the motherboard that was introduced by Intel in 2004. It was designed to replace ATX.  The micro versions have 4 slots instead of 7

    Spec Year Dimensions slots
    BTX 2004 10.5 × 12.8 in
    7
    microBTX 10.5 × 10.4 in
    4
    nanoBTX 10.5 × 8.8 in
    2
    picoBTX 10.5 × 8.0 in
    1
    Size ATX BTX
    Full-Form ATX stands for Advanced Technology eXtended BTX stands for Balanced Technology eXtended
    Meaning ATX is a form factor of the motherboard which was introduced to replace the standard AT design. BTX is a form factor of the motherboard which was initially designed to replace ATX.
    Invented ATX was first introduced in 1995 by Intel. It was introduced in late 2004 and early 2005 by Intel.
    Airflow & cooling ATX board design and component location block airflow. Thus, less cooling. BTX solved this problem and has better airflow, hence more cooling.
